I. History of Case

This is a civil action for penalties and injunctive relief predicated on section 113(b) of the Clean Air Act, 42 U.S.C. § 7413(b) (1970). The United States of America, by the Environmental Protection Agency (EPA), alleges that defendant's steelmaking plant at Farrell, Pennsylvania, violates the clean air standards delineated in the Act.
